Bain owns and operates his own law office which focuses on criminal defense, family and personal injury law, among other specialties. He earned his J.D. from Mississippi College School of Law and was admitted to the state bar in 2006. [1][2]

Elections
2011
On November 8, 2011, Bain won election to District 2 of the Mississippi House of Representatives. He ran unchallenged in the August 2 primary and defeated Republican A.L. Wood in the November 8 general election. [3]

Campaign donors
2011
In 2011, Bain received $63,078 in campaign donations. The top contributors are listed below.[4]
